Calculate the gram amount of imidazole and volume of 10X PBS and water to use to make 10mL of a solution that is 1X PBS and 500mM imidazole

Calculate the gram amount of imidazole and volume of 10X PBS and water to use to make 10mL of a solution that is 1X PBS and 25mM imidazole.

Solution

Ans. Part 1:

# Required moles of imidazole = Molarity x Volume of solution in liters

                                                            = 0.500 M x 0.010 L

                                                            = 0.005 mol

Required mass of imidazole = Required moles x Molar mass

                                                = 0.005 mol x (68.077 g/ mol)

                                                = 0.1159 g

# Using           C1V1 (10X PBS) = C2V2 (1 X PBS)

            Or, (10X x V1) = (1X x 10 mL)

Or, V1 = (1X x 10 mL) / 10X = 1.0 mL

Therefore, required volume of 10X PBS solution = 1.0 mL

# Required volume of water = Total volume – Volume of 10X PBS taken

                                                = 10.0 mL – 1.0 mL

                                                = 9.0 mL

Note: It’s assume that addition of imidazole does not affect the volume of solution.

Part 2:

# Required moles of imidazole = Molarity x Volume of solution in liters

                                                            = 0.025 M x 0.010 L

                                                            = 0.00025 mol

Required mass of imidazole = Required moles x Molar mass

                                                = 0.00025 mol x (68.077 g/ mol)

                                                = 0.0170 g

# Using           C1V1 (10X PBS) = C2V2 (1 X PBS)

            Or, (10X x V1) = (1X x 10 mL)

Or, V1 = (1X x 10 mL) / 10X = 1.0 mL

Therefore, required volume of 10X PBS solution = 1.0 mL

# Required volume of water = Total volume – Volume of 10X PBS taken

                                                = 10.0 mL – 1.0 mL

                                                = 9.0 mL

Note: It’s assume that addition of imidazole does not affect the volume of solution.
